Funeral services for Wayne Gillespie, 70, of Lufkin, will be held Tuesday, May 8, 2012 at 10:00 a.m. in the Carroway Funeral Home Chapel in Lufkin with Brother Bud Davis officiating. Graveside services will follow at 1:00 p.m. Tuesday in the Chinquapin Cemetery in San Augustine County.
Mr. Gillespie was born April 9, 1942 in Nacogdoches County, Texas, to the late Clemmie (Allen) and R.L. Gillespie He died Saturday, May 5, 2012 at his residence.
Mr. Gillespie enjoyed fishing, hunting and spending time with the grandchildren. He was a generous and compassionate businessman. From the rental stores, the sawmills, and his real estate ventures, he touched the lives of many. Mr. Gillespie had resided in Lufkin for the past 35 years.
